What is it?

Intended for both the new hobby sysadmin and experienced DevOps professional.
This set of guides & build tools is aimed at the Single Host Laptop/Desktop/Server Development and Education Paradigm and can be expanded upon once the core fundamentals are understood.

By following these guides you will be able to:

  1. Demostrate the significant potential of reasonably equipped hardware
  2. Improve your understandng and fluency in fitting common commercial software components together
  3. Overcome barriers in consuming automation tools to improve your workflow beyond the burden of menial tasks

Purpose:

Provide a community platform to quickly and seamlessly build high impact education and development environments.

Inspiration:

The original inspiration for this project came from a desire to have meaningful hands on expreince with a platform that represents the leading edge of modern systems engineering at scale. This design serves to solve for the frustrations and blockers encountered after endless hours of testing different virtual network solutions, architectures, and strategies in search of a paradigm that meets a number of criteria included in the following.
